How to stick with your 2017 resolutions

Know what you couldn’t achieve in 2016


What did you want in 2016 and couldn’t achieve? It’s essential to know this because when you do, you’ll know your irrelevant and relevant wants in 2016. Also, when you know what you couldn’t achieve in 2016, you’ll be able to add that to your 2017 resolutions.

Know what you’d like to achieve in 2017

What would you like to get? What milestone do you want to pass? Knowing these would give you the perfect inspiration as to what resolution you should get.

Why didn’t you achieve what you wanted in 2016

What mistakes did you make? What step did you jump? Knowing this is beneficial so that you wouldn’t make same mistake you did in 2016. Note that everything successful has steps to follow

Know what you can do to achieve your 2017 resolutions

When you’ve finally known your mistakes in 2016, the next step for you is how you can make less room for errors in 2017. How can you? Learn from your mistakes.

Plan daily

Calmly take your time to plan what to the next day everyday. When you do this, you’ll review today and find ways to make tomorrow better. You’ll also make a daily to-do list

Make 2017 easier by sticking with your priority list

A priority list is a list of your goals arranged from most important to least important. When you follow your priority list, you won’t make irrelevant actions you’ll later regret

Be with only people who add value to your life

These set of people who add value to your life would make your priority list easily followed by you. Don’t be with people who add negative value (unneeded value) to your life. You’ll see how your goals are easily reached
